Schneider Electric is expanding its EcoStruxure IT data center Infrastructure Management Tooling (DCIM) with a new user-friendly sustainability component. This allows IT administrators to view and monitor important sustainability parameters such as PUE per server room at the touch of a button. Schneider says that collecting such data has traditionally been a labor-intensive task, but thanks to data analysis based on models and algorithms, a useful overview can now be obtained in just a few seconds.

The introduction of the new functions in the EcpStruxure solutions is part of the DCIM 3.0 vision that Schneider presented a year and a half ago. The company wants to support sustainability goals. Specifically, the company is guided by the European Energy Efficiency Directive (EED), which requires very specific reporting from parties with large IT footprints.

Important data, immediately visible

Schneider Electric shows exactly what the new capacity entails. All administrators need to do is specify which room specific devices are located in their DCIM software. You can then immediately view parameters such as the PUE (Effectiveness of power consumption usage), DCiE (Data center infrastructure efficiency), consult the total energy consumption and the energy consumption for cooling. Schneider keeps track of numbers per month and displays charts that allow administrators to quickly compare months across years.

What used to require constant work with a lot of specialist knowledge can now be done very quickly and precisely. If the furnishings of a room change, simply indicate this and the numbers will be adjusted automatically. Schneider performs all the necessary calculations based on the extensive telemetry data from its devices as well as an underlying model built from years of collected data. This model makes some assumptions that are very accurate in theory, but can still be adjusted in practice if a user with the necessary expertise so desires.

Magical reporting

“The solution almost feels like magic,” says Bjarke Fenger, Head of Product Management DCIM. The simplicity will soon come in handy as Europe needs to mandate reporting of DCIM parameters under EED. Administrators can therefore export the data from the EcoStruxure environment into a PDF, but also into CSV files. Getting started with the data in other tools is also an option.

“We worked hard to develop this solution,” said Kevin Brown, SVP ExoStructure IT. Our report does not cover all the parameters required for EED reporting, but it covers about eighty percent.” He further points out that the tool takes into account all relevant IT components, from the large data center to the smallest server rack Edge.

Availability

Schneider will roll out sustainability reporting to EcoStruxure IT Expert before the end of the first quarter. The functionality is included in the subscription to this cloud solution. In the second quarter, the solution will come to EcoStruxure IT Advisor, which offers a more advanced digital twin solution. Finally, ExoStruxure IT Data Center Expert customers can begin model-driven sustainability monitoring in the third quarter of this year.
